Hello all, My wife and I are planning a months trip to Egypt. We haven't booked flights as of yet as we are wondering where to go to dive for the month. My wife does get motion sick so we are looking for a place that offers the best shore dives or has the shortest boat trips to get to the dive sites. We have been to Dahab before and know that lots of shore dives are possible there, but we are looking for another place to go this time. Any tips would be appreciated. Thanks in advance.

Hi David, I've been to egypt 7 times (shortest diving was 8 days, longest 3 weeks). I've done Sharm el-Sheikh and Dahab. I prefer Sharm by far, however time out to sites is between 30 and 45 mins (but on bigger boats than what I saw in Dahab, usually helps with sea-sickness).
There are 2 jettys in Sharm (Sharks bay used for Tiran, and Travco used for local - still 30 mins of boat time and Ras Mohammed). There is a third that I've used, but only for Thistlegorm, and that's a 3 hour boat ride, so I'm guessing that's not an option for you.
Most if not all hotels also offer shore dives, and the local reefs are also very nice (although I prefer the depth of the local reefs in the Shark's bay area, as it's more of a cliff with a wall vs the sandy beach bottom that I saw in Na'ama bay. I've been down to 27 meters on the local reefs, so while not quite as varied, since you are still jumping off the same pier every time, but not limited to snorkeling depth. I would suggest that you go to Sharm, and alternate as needed between taking boat days and shore days to the extent that you and your wife feel comfortable. I've attached a pic of Angelina, one of the dive boats in the sharm area - empty because there are no tourists now, but it give you an idea of the boat size in Sharm vs Dahab.

I can't speak for Hurghada or Marsa Alam, never been.
Has your wife tried using gravol to fend off the sea-sickness?

Marsa Alam. Red Sea Diving Safari. There are excellent house reefs. If completely averse to a boat then they do excursions by truck further south so other shore dives. Otherwise, Elphinstore is a few miles (7?) offshore and there are various somewhat local boat dives too.

I really like the place.

PS, they have a chamber across the road too.
 
Another vote for RSDS Marsa Shagra Camp. Very nice house reef with unlimited diving, just grab a tank and your buddy and dive. As pointed out, Elphinstone straight out from camp. If the sea is calm boat ride is easy as pie ... no worries. Lots of shore dives in the area and trips every day.
